Heavenly Father,

We come before You today, our hearts heavy with the weight of the world and the cries of innocent lives, particularly those of mothers and their unborn children. We lift up the words of Exodus 21:22, “If men strive, and hurt a woman with child, so that her fruit depart from her, and yet no mischief follow: he shall be surely punished, according as the woman's husband will lay upon him; and he shall pay as the judges determine.” Lord, this verse resonates deeply in our hearts, as it speaks to the sanctity of life and the called duty for justice in the face of harm.

Father, we acknowledge Your sovereign hand in the creation of life, especially in the womb. You knit each child together with purpose and intention. We thank You for the precious gift of motherhood, for the sacred bond between a mother and her child. In this divine act, we see Your reflection, and we are reminded of how valuable each life is to You. We ask for Your divine protection over all expectant mothers. Keep them safe from harm, and guard their health and well-being as they nurture the life that You have placed within them.

Lord, we recognize that our world is fraught with conflict and strife, sometimes resulting in physical harm to those who are carrying new life. We pray for the women who find themselves in vulnerable situations, who may face aggression or violence from those around them. Protect these mothers, Lord, and shield them from aggression, hatred, and malice. Surround them with Your peace that transcends all understanding. May they feel Your presence with them, offering comfort and strength amidst turmoil.

As the verse reminds us, there must be accountability for actions that lead to harm, especially when it comes to the vulnerable. We pray for justice, Lord. We ask that You raise up individuals who will advocate for these mothers and their children, those who will seek righteousness in a world that often turns a blind eye to such matters. We ask for Your wisdom to be granted to the judges and leaders who make decisions that affect lives. May their hearts be tender and understanding, guided by compassion and integrity. Let them enforce justice where it is due, and disallow injustice and irresponsibility to prevail.

Father, we also seek healing for those mothers who have suffered loss due to violence or neglect. Heal their broken hearts and mending their spirits, filling them with hope and renewal. We pray they may find solace in Your embrace and that You guide them toward paths of restoration. In their pain, may they feel Your love surrounding them, reminding them they are not alone, nor forgotten.

As we come to You in prayer, we ask that our community be a champion for the causes of life and justice. Stir within us a passion to serve those who are voiceless, especially the unborn. Raise our awareness to speak out against injustices committed against mothers and their children. May we stretch out our hands in empathy and compassion, comforting those in distress and lending our voices to those who lack one.

In all things, we look to You, our just and righteous Judge. We put our trust in Your perfect timing and wisdom as we navigate these complex issues in our society. May the hearts of men be turned toward the value of life and the sanctity of the family. Strengthen us as we strive to live out Your commandments, showing love and protection to all, especially the most vulnerable among us.

In Your Holy Name, we pray, Amen.
